THE USE OF MNEMONIC TECHNIQUEIN IMPROVING STUDENTS' MASTERY OF PAST TENSE: A QUASI-EXPERIMENTAL RESEARCH IN EIGHT GRADE STUDENTSOF A JUNIOR HIGH SCHOOL IN BANDUNG
Teaching a language cannot be separated from teaching its grammar. Teaching English, therefore involves teaching English grammar as well.
